Obituary of Allene G. Miller
Allene G. Miller was born on September 6, 1944 in Indianapolis, Indiana to the late William Sr. and Myrtle Tuggle. She was the mother of three children. At the age of 76, she went home to be with her Lord and Savior Jesus Christ on June 7, 2021, in her home surrounded by her family. Throughout Allene's life she was known to be energetic, and a faithful servant of God. She was a life-long member of St. Paul A.M.E Church, having been a member since birth. She served as a secretary for many years for the Mary F. Handy Missionary Society. She also served as a volunteer and member for the Senior Usher board, Senior Lay Organization, and the St. Paul Kid's Night Out Ministry. Allene attended Crispus Attucks High School, and attended Ivy Tech Community college. She was employed at Thompson Electronic (R.C.A.). She then worked for IPS as a monitor and later as a bus driver for the Durham School District, where she found her second family, and became a positive union leader. She enjoyed trips to the casino, shopping, bowling, playing cards, going on vacation, and family dinners at her daughters house every Sunday. Allene would be elated in knowing that her resting place will be beside her baby girl, Alicia, standing in God's Kingdom for eternity. Allene was preceded in death by her parents: William Sr. & Myrtle Tuggle, daughter: Alicia E. Miller, son: Andrew E. MillerJr, and her sister: Patricia Tuggle. Allene is survived by her husband: Andrew E. Miller, a very devoted daughter: Karllena Brady, sister: Cecelia White, brother: William (Flortencia) Tuggle Jr., grandchildren: Richard & Charisse Wells, and Andrew Brady, and a number of nephews, nieces, church family, and friends.
